Who Benefits from AI Gains?
When companies automate workflows, productivity increases. Therefore, responsible workforce planning requires thoughtful leadership choices:
-Invest in Retraining: Leaders can reinvest efficiency gains into employee upskilling.
-Redesign Roles: Managers can shift workers away from repetitive tasks.
-Communicate Clearly: Leaders must create honest dialogue about automated forecasts. As a result, they reduce employee fear around AI job security.
What Responsible Planning Requires
Automation should support human workers, not replace them. Therefore, responsible workforce planning keeps people at the center. Leaders must use technology to empower teams. Moreover, they should avoid using tools purely for cost-cutting.
By making ethical decisions, leaders build strong organizations. In addition, they protect worker trust.
